The Risks of Addiction
Gambling can be a slippery slope, especially for those in the limelight. The pressure to maintain a certain lifestyle and image can lead celebrities to gamble excessively, risking their financial stability and mental health. The thrill of winning may quickly turn into a cycle of loss, pushing some individuals into gambling addiction. Awareness of this risk is crucial, as it can have devastating effects on their lives.
The celebrity status often complicates the issue, as public scrutiny and media attention can either exacerbate the problem or create stigma around seeking help. It’s essential to recognize the signs of gambling addiction and understand that even those who appear to have it all can struggle with this issue.
